What impact did Sigmund Freud's theories have on surrealist poetry?
Sigmund Freud's theories on the subconscious greatly influenced surrealist poetry by providing a framework for exploring the human psyche. His ideas on dreams, repression, and free association fueled the surrealist emphasis on the irrational and the spontaneous.
Freud's exploration of the hidden aspects of the mind encouraged surrealist poets to delve into unconscious imagery and challenge the boundaries between reality and fantasy.
